Abstract

Shallow invasion could result in pathological processes of placenta leading to fetal growth restriction (FGR) in singletons and twins. Osteopontin (OPN) plays an important role in trophoblast invasion. So our study aims to investigate the expression level of OPN in placenta of discordant monochorionic (MC) twins. OPN expression was compared in the placental samples of 10 discordant MC twins and 12 concordant MC twins. OPN levels were evaluated using quantitative Real-time PCR and western blot. Our results showed that OPN expression at mRNA and protein level was significantly decreased in placenta (p < 0.05) of small fetuses in discordant MC twins. The expression level of OPN transcript strongly correlated with the territory of placenta.
